As expected, we had a crazy day! BUT we made it thanks to all of the extra help! 291 families, which is 800 people, were able to get food today due to all of you who came to volunteer and all of you who kept bringing in food and money for food. Now we work on Saturday. Clothing only pantry is Thurs 11-4, donations can be dropped off as well. We will have someone at pantry for donations only Friday. We are not open for distribution but people can drop donations off from 10-3. Thank you everyone for keeping this going and making sure all get food! ... See MoreSee Less

Today was hard.....Tomorrow will be harder......
We welcomed so many new faces today, as a significant amount of federal workers, who just are out of $$ came to get food. They continue to work, unpaid, for their community. But the money has dried up and no paycheck in sight. Some drove a long distance, as their was no closer help.
Tomorrow morning, Nov 5, when families wake up and there is no money on that SNAP card, real panic will happen. I already have moms saying " I don't need to eat, as long as my children get food." BUT these Moms and Dads WORK, they have JOBS, just not jobs that pay enough to afford all the food they need. They must eat to work.
We remain here. We remain strong. We will work together, and do what must be done to get the food out. I am not alone in this, other food banks, pantries, and kitchens feel the same way. We need every ones' help! We all do. Food donations, any size, money donations, any size. We will get thru this, people will have food, because we spread hope, kindness, and love. 1

All day I have been ask 2 questions: Will families get EBT ( SNAP) now that it is court ordered? and What do you guys need?
1. EBT is a very Gray area. Trump said he was going to release HALF of the funds for Nov. but that is all. However, he is not sure how fast this can happen. It has been stated that HALF may not even come for a few weeks or longer. SO it's not a lot of help immediately.
2. What do we need? WOW that is a big one. We still need so many Thanksgiving things as we are almost at our 2500 box limit. Of course Money is usually great, as we get very deep discounts. That being said, Thanksgiving still needs turkeys, canned yams, desserts ( pie filling, pudding, cake mixes, etc ), cranberry sauce, gravy packets, stuffing, green beans, corn, jiffy cornbread mix, cream of mushroom, and mac n cheese. But due to the current situation, our shelves are in bad need of love as well, so pasta. pasta sauce, canned meats, canned beans esp baked beans, spagettio type things, SOUPS, ramen, pasta and rice dishes like knorr noodles or rice a roni, oatmeal, baking items like flour, oils, and sugar, baby formula, etc. Honestly, we are NOT picky, we are thrilled with anything. Yes we take perishables, yes we take produce, yes we have a donation box out back for non perishables.
